| # π Translation Engine API | |
| A high-performance, multi-engine Translation API built with **FastAPI** and **Scalar**. | |
| This Space serves local CPU-optimized machine learning models alongside cloud API providers. It is designed to act as the primary translation backend for an upcoming **Django web application**, but functions completely as a **standalone REST API**. | |

| ## Available Translation Engines | |
| ### 1. Local CPU Models (Offline & Private) | |
| Local models are automatically downloaded, quantized to **INT8 / GGUF** format, and cached in ephemeral storage for fast CPU execution with minimal RAM footprint. | |
| | Model ID | Provider Name | Base Weights | Precision | Target Languages / Features | | |
| | :--- | :--- | :--- | :--- | :--- | | |
| | `nllb` | **NLLB-200 (600M)** | Meta `nllb-200-distilled-600M` | `int8` | Fast general translation (200+ languages) | | |
| | `nllb_1_3b` | **NLLB-200 (1.3B)** | Meta `nllb-200-distilled-1.3B` | `int8` | Higher accuracy general translation | | |
| | `afrinllb` | **AfriNLLB (600M)** | `AfriNLP/AfriNLLB-12enc-12dec-full-ft-kd` | `int8` | Knowledge-distilled for 15+ African languages | | |
| | `madlad` | **MADLAD-400 (3B)** | `google/madlad400-3b-mt` | `int8` | Multilingual translation across 400+ languages | | |
| | `swahili_gemma` | **Swahili Gemma (1B)** | `CraneAILabs/swahili-gemma-1b-GGUF` | `Q4_K_M` | Fine-tuned for English β Swahili translation | | |
| ### 2. Cloud API Engines (Bring-Your-Own-Key) | |
| Cloud API providers allow accessing large language models. You can either configure environment variables on the server or pass your API key dynamically in the JSON payload per request. | |
| | Provider ID | Provider Name | Default Model | Required Client Key | | |
| | :--- | :--- | :--- | :--- | | |
| | `gemini` | **Google Gemini** | `gemini-1.5-flash` | `api_key` (Gemini API Key) | | |
| | `groq` | **Groq LLaMA** | `llama-3.3-70b-versatile` | `api_key` (Groq API Key) | | |
| | `groq_qwen` | **Groq Qwen** | `qwen-2.5-coder-32b` | `api_key` (Groq API Key) | | |

| ## How to Use the API | |
| ### 1. Check Available Engines | |
| ```bash | |
| GET / | |
| ``` | |
| ### 2. Translate via Local Model (e.g., AfriNLLB) | |
| ```bash | |
| POST /translate | |
| Content-Type: application/json | |
| { | |
| "text": "Is it not a beautiful Tuesday morning?", | |
| "source": "eng_Latn", | |
| "target": "swh_Latn", | |
| "engine": "afrinllb" | |
| } | |
| ``` | |
| ### 3. Translate via Cloud API (Passing API Key dynamically) | |
| If no server-side API key is set, clients can supply their own key directly: | |
| ```bash | |
| POST /translate | |
| Content-Type: application/json | |
| { | |
| "provider": "gemini", | |
| "text": "Good morning, how can I help you today?", | |
| "src": "en", | |
| "tgt": "sw", | |
| "api_key": "YOUR_GEMINI_API_KEY_HERE" | |
| } | |
| ``` | |

| ## Environment Variables Configuration | |
| If you are hosting this Space yourself or running it locally, you can set optional environment keys in Space Settings: | |
| ```env | |
| # Optional Cloud Keys (If set, clients do not need to provide their own keys) | |
| GEMINI_API_KEY=your_gemini_key | |
| GROQ_API_KEY=your_groq_key | |
| # CTranslate2 / CPU Threading Controls | |
| OMP_NUM_THREADS=8 | |
| CT2_COMPUTE_TYPE=int8 | |
| ``` | |
